摘要:Gears are extensively used in many applications, such as: automotive, drive trains, industrial gearboxes and machine tools. They are designed to transmit power and rotational motion from the input shaft to the output shaft. In the design process of a gearbox, factors such as: load capacity, size, lifetime or manufacturing cost are often taken into consideration. However, precise measures of efficiency are frequently forgotten issues in the design process. Such shortfalls relate to oil churning, wind age, oil squeezing during gear mesh, or the friction processes at the level of the gear pairs, seals and bearings. This paper presents a calculation method used to determine the efficiency of helical gear transmissions. The method was validated by experimental measurements. Finally, influence factors on the gearbox efficiency, such astransmitted load and operating speed are presented.
